El Manual de atención básica veterinaria para tortugas marinas varadas vivas en Perú”

El Manual de atención básica veterinaria para tortugas marinas varadas vivas en Perú” ha sido elaborado para que médicos veterinarios en Perú puedan colaborar con las autoridades encargadas en la evaluación, diagnóstico y recuperación de una tortuga marina en dicho estado. Además, compila y adapta información de diversas publicaciones y guías para veterinarios, así como la experiencia de los especialistas que han colaborado en su preparación.

Guía de Buenas Prácticas para la Manipulación y Liberación Segura de Fauna Marina No Objetivo Capturada en Redes de Cerco

Esta guía fue elaborada con el propósito de promover buenas prácticas en la pesquería de cerco, convirtiéndose en un esfuerzo por brindar herramientas necesarias a tripulantes, patrones, armadores y empresas que operan en esta actividad, ya sea en el ámbito industrial y/o artesanal. En dicho sentido, esta guía brinda información sobre técnicas de manipulación y liberación de algunos vertebrados marinos capturados incidentalmente por las redes de cerco. La guía incluye opciones de liberación dependiendo de la disponibilidad de herramientas dentro de la embarcación o el tipo de sistema (ej. mecánico o manual).

COVID-19 impacts on the South African Small-Scale Fisheries Sector

In this presentation, Dr Bernadette Snow, Nelson Mandela University, shares early inter-disciplinary research findings on the effects of COVID-19 and the related lock-down measures on the small-scale fisheries sector in South Africa.

Namibia’s Experience on Implementation of the Voluntary Guidelines on Small-Scale Fisheries (Part 1)

The aim of the webinar is to cross-share experiences between the Namibia Ministry of Fisheries and Marine Resources, as well as key national, regional and international partners and stakeholders in the small-scale fisheries (SSF) sector on developments, plans and programmes to support of the development of the SSF Sector. This webinar is designed to provide evidence required to support the development and realisation of a National Plan of Action for Small-Scale Fisheries in Namibia (NPOA-SSF).

Small-scale fishers and ocean well-being

This roundtable will highlight the often-overlooked connections between the lives and livelihoods of Small-Scale Fishers, their role and risks as environmental human rights defenders, and the needs and opportunities to work with Small-Scale Fishers as crucial partners in the conservation, sustainable use and restoration of marine biodiversity in the face of a changing climate.
